Verdict

INDIAN LILAC chased home the very smart Peaceful on her sole 2-y-o start last October and, though absent since, she may well be the answer given her obvious scope for improvement. Orchid Gardens and Pin Your Hopes have both been knocking on the door pretty loudly and are live dangers, while Battle of Benburb's recent Navan debut was encouraging and the 4-y-o Longbourn is not without hope either.
